The Taihu Recreation area is a park centered on Taihu. The park covers an area of 45 hectares; the August 23 Artillery War Museum is located here, giving the park a special historical significance. With a surface area of 36 hectares, Taihu is Kinmen's largest man-made freshwater lake; completed in 1965, it contains three islands topped by elegant pavilions. A Ming Dynasty (A.D. 1368-1644) residence in the park has been excavated from the sand and restored, giving an additional touch of interest to the area.
